This event is for frontline professionals and community workers who want to understand more about Honour Based Abuse and Forced Marriage.

Learning outcomes

• To explore what is meant by the terms ‘honour-based abuse’ (HBA) and ‘forced marriage’ (FM)

• To raise awareness of communities where HBA and FM are prevalent

• To examine current legislation

• To gain an understanding of the effects of HBA and FM

• To inform delegates of appropriate referral pathways and help available

Prerequisites

None. Please note we advise all professionals attend our flagship course, Understanding and responding to Domestic Violence and Abuse.
